Religion ‘weaponised’ against the poor – Aisha Yesufu
A renown human right activist, Aisha Yesufu, has berated the Hisbah security operatives in Kano State over inhuman treatment of student in Kano State for not being a Muslim.
Aisha Yesufu, lamenting over a report by @SaharaReporterstitled: “Islamic Police, Hisbah Officials, Shave Hair Of Secondary School Pupils In Kano For Being ‘UnIslamic’”, declared that religion is being ‘weaponised’ against the poor.
Aisha also protested that while government schools are usually dilapidated, private schools where the children of the masters attend are never.
According to Aisha Yesufu @AishaYesufu “As usual, in a dilapidated government school, never at the private schools that the children of their masters are.
“Religion being weaponised against the poor.” @SaharaReporters
